Location of the Hogwarts.
Location of the castle (The school is located in an ancient eight-story castle in Scotland (possibly in Argyllshire - the map of this county hangs on the third floor). On the school grounds, in addition to the castle, there is a mountain lake, a large forest called the "Forbidden Forest" because of the dangerous creatures living there, greenhouses, several auxiliary buildings, and a Quidditch field. The castle is surrounded by mountains. The nearest settlement is the small village of Hogsmeade - the only village in England not inhabited by Muggles. The closest train station to Hogwarts is also located there. A special train, the Hogwarts Express, runs between Hogsmeade and London, taking students to school three times a year and three times for the holidays (summer, Christmas and Easter). On the map, the station is located to the southeast of the school, and the village of Hogsmeade is to the northwest. To get from Hogsmeade to the castle, first-years cross the lake in small boats, while older students travel to the castle in carriages pulled by Thestrals, winged horses. In winter, the same journey can be made in a horse-drawn carriage right across the lake. Entry to the castle grounds is through the gates. The columns they rest on are topped with statues of winged boars, as Hogwarts means "boar" in some ancient language. There are probably two reasons why students get to Hogwarts by water for the first time in their lives. Firstly, it is unknown who will see the Thestrals: the little ones might get scared. Secondly, water is a strong magical substance, perhaps the lake gives a "pass" to the castle. The school is enchanted in such a way that to Muggles it looks like ruins with a "No Entry" sign. Electrical and electronic devices in Hogwarts do not work because there is too much magic there.)

Curriculum
Curriculum (All subjects studied at school are related to magic in one way or another. With the exception of astronomy, no subject is taught in regular schools, although there are similar ones (potions instead of chemistry, history of magic instead of history, numerology instead of mathematics, herbology instead of botany, care of magical creatures instead of zoology). Astronomy stands out, since such a subject is also offered in Muggle schools. There are eight compulsory subjects: potions, history of magic, transfiguration, spells, astronomy, herbology, defense against the dark arts, broomstick flying. All these subjects are compulsory from the first to the fifth year. Starting from the third year, students, along with the compulsory ones, are offered electives: Divination, Care of Magical Creatures, Study of Ancient Runes, Muggle Studies, numerology. Education in the last two years is optional. In the last two years, students study fewer subjects, but at a more in-depth level. The classes become much more difficult. In addition, the student may not be admitted to the classes due to insufficient grades. In their sixth year, Hogwarts students can study Apparition and take an exam. Apparition is taught not by one of the teachers, but by an official of the Ministry of Magic. Only students who have reached the age of 17 are allowed to take the exam. Apparition courses are paid. It is not said whether the native language and literature, as well as foreign languages, are studied at Hogwarts. It seems that at least literature is not studied. However, a student can choose fiction. There is a possibility that Music is studied at Hogwarts. However, most likely, this subject is one of the extracurricular clubs that exist at Hogwarts. The most famous of them are: Potions Club, Gobstones Club, Charms Club.)
